[-- Attachment #1 --] vermaden wrote in <wwfdqcbrxyogknjtjiew@gryk>: > I also just tested the 'online' install of PKGBASE and noticed one thing. > > In the 'Offline' install the pkg(8) is bootstrapped. > > In the 'Online' install the pkg(8) is NOT bootstrapped. it will be bootstrapped if it's in the repository; the problem right now is it's in the offline repository (that we provide on the media) but it's not in the base repository on pkg.freebsd.org, which is what the online install uses. this should be fixed at some point before release, since re@ will build a new re-managed base repository that will include pkg.
